Although spam is a known problem on Telegram, no, Telegram itself is very reputable in the privacy space and they do not sell your information.

The reason these random people can message you is usually by searching for random usernames in the Telegram global search and messaging random people. (Telegram usernames are like global X handles, for example.) If you don't want to be reachable by strangers, you can remove your username or set it to something uncommon.

People can't message you by phone number unless they are in your contacts.

You can make changes in Settings. In the "Privacy and Security" section, select "Messages" and toggle the setting so that only your Contacts and Premium Users can send messages.
